How to enable the telnet client in windows 10 posted by jarrod on april 18, 2015 leave a comment 62 go to comments by default the telnet client in microsofts windows operating systems is disabled, this is unfortunate as it is an extremely useful tool which can be used for testing tcp connectivity to external hosts on a specified port.
